
italo777
(usa CentOS)
Enviado em 03/10/2011 - 21:12h
olá pessoal sou novo aqui no VOL
e preciso da ajuda de vcs para resolver um problema:
bem, tenho um servidor rodando o proxy squid (versão 2.7 stable9)
configurei o meu navegador MANUALMENTE para acessar o proxy...
então resolvi configurar o proxy transparente
fui no arquivo squid.conf coloquei
http_port 3128 transparent
configurei o iptables para fazer o redirecionamento de porta
aí esta meu script de firewall
echo 1>/proc/sys/net/ipv4/ip_forward
modprobe ip_tables
modprobe iptable_nat
iptables -F
iptables -t nat -F
iptables -t nat -A POSTROUTING -o eth0 -j MASQUERADE
iptables -t nat -A PREROUTING -p tcp -s 192.168.247.0/24 --dport 80 -j REDIRECT --to-port 3128
O que me deixa furioso é que o endereçamento ip está correto
tato mais por que configurando manualmente no navegador ele funciona, agora quando ativo o proxy transparente nada funciona
nem cache nem regras nem nada...
vou ficar aguardando ajuda de vcs.